Output 21d14db8a0263cb1813847891aa75f37ee3dfed5c6db95acbac0baee2b2e3281:1

value
89047591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e91b94cf6e80b497a014e47fd8dbd43bc704834e OP_EQUAL
address
3NwaQd2FXR4d7GtmBH8t8exQ7ziPVvVKVX
transaction
21d14db8a0263cb1813847891aa75f37ee3dfed5c6db95acbac0baee2b2e3281
confirmations
246131
spent
true